What a device classification tool has to check, and where most stop

A device classification tool that returns Class II and stops has answered a real question and quietly dropped a second one that determines almost everything about what happens next: does this device also qualify for the 510(k) exemption most Class II devices get, or does it fall outside that exemption's limits. Both questions trace to actual regulatory text — 21 CFR 860.3 for the class, 21 CFR Parts 862 through 892 for the exemption and its limits — and a tool that collapses them into one output is hiding the branch where most classification mistakes actually happen.

Classification is a risk judgment about the device type

21 CFR 860.3 sorts devices into Class I, subject to general controls, Class II, where general controls alone aren't enough and special controls close the gap, and Class III, reserved for devices where neither is sufficient to provide reasonable assurance of safety and effectiveness — typically because the device is life-supporting, life-sustaining, or presents a potential unreasonable risk of illness or injury. That determination is made for a generic type of device, not a specific product, and it's set out in the classification regulation for that device type under 21 CFR Parts 862 through 892. A tool that gets a user to the right class has done real, source-mapped work. It hasn't yet told them what to file.

Most Class I and Class II devices don't need a 510(k) — up to a limit

FDA has exempted the large majority of Class I device types, and many Class II types, from the requirement to submit a premarket notification at all. But every one of those classification regulations carries its own limitations-of-exemption section — numbered .9 within that part, for example 21 CFR 862.9 for clinical chemistry devices — and the exemption only holds to the extent the device has the existing or reasonably foreseeable characteristics of devices already on the market in that generic type. A device that has a different intended use, uses a different fundamental scientific technology, or is a reprocessed single-use version of an otherwise-exempt type exceeds the exemption regardless of what class it's in, and a 510(k) is required after all.

Why the exemption limit is the branch, not a footnote

This is the exact place a classification answer collapses two different questions into one confident-looking output. “What class is this device” and “does this specific device still qualify for that class's exemption” are answered by different sections of the CFR, checked against different facts about the device, and a tool that only asks the first question will tell a sponsor with a reprocessed, exemption-exceeding device that they're clear to market, when the regulation says the opposite. The same rule that makes a checklist item trustworthy applies to a tool's output: one claim, one citation, checkable against the source — not a single answer standing in for two separate determinations.

For the devices that do need a 510(k), the classification question ends and a different one starts

A device that needs a 510(k) — because it's Class III, or because it exceeded its exemption — moves to a wholly separate test: substantial equivalence, defined at Section 513(i) of the FD&C Act and applied under 21 CFR 807.100(b), which asks whether the device has the same intended use as a predicate and either the same technological characteristics or characteristics that don't raise different questions of safety and effectiveness. That's a different regulatory question from classification, decided against a different predicate-specific record, and it's the one an Acceptance Review checks for completeness on without ever judging whether the answer is right. A classification tool that hands a user off cleanly at this boundary — you need a 510(k), and here is the specific test it has to pass — is doing its job. One that just says Class II never gets the user to that boundary at all.
